Woman Denying to Give Donation Killed

2012-01-19

Banke / January 19

Nanda Yadav, 50, a resident at Chaupheri of Holiya2 has been shot dead by cadres of Terai Madhes Mukti Party (Bhagat Singh) on January 18.

 

Cadres of the party had fired at Nanda at her house which is located in Indo-Nepal border. She had spot death. The party cadres had fired at her alleging that she did not provide them donation. They had fired at Nanda when her husband Bahadur Yadav had gone to Nepalgunj, said Bikram Singh Thapa, SP at Banke District Police Office.

 

Police have arrested two persons for their alleged involvement in the murder of Nanda.

 

The incident site lies some 16 kilometers east from Nepalgunj. Khadaicha Police Post is located some three kilometers from the site.

 

Former chairperson of Holiya VDC Rana Bahadur Thakur said that locals across Rapti River living in Indo Nepal border have been terrified after the incident. He demanded that the local administration establish a police post in the VDC.
